#6e4ea4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6e4ea4 is composed of 43.1% red, 30.6% green and 64.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 32.9% cyan, 52.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 35.7% black. It has a hue angle of 262.3 degrees, a saturation of 35.5% and a lightness of 47.5%. #6e4ea4 color hex could be obtained by blending #dc9cff with #000049. Closest websafe color is: #666699.

#6e4ea4 color description : Dark moderate violet.

#6e4ea4 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#6e4ea4 has RGB values of R:110, G:78, B:164 and CMYK values of C:0.33, M:0.52, Y:0, K:0.36. Its decimal value is 7229092.

Shades and Tints of #6e4ea4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030204 is the darkest color, while #f8f6f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#6e4ea4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#78737f is the less saturated color, while #5b04ee is the most saturated one.
